What Are the Common Applications of Inverted Microscopes?

Inverted microscopes find widespread use in various scientific disciplines:

Cell Biology:

Cell Culture Observation: Monitoring cell growth, proliferation, and morphology in real-time.  

Cell-to-Cell Interactions: Studying interactions between cells, such as cell migration, adhesion, and phagocytosis.  

Intracellular Processes: Observing intracellular events like mitosis, meiosis, and organelle dynamics.  

Microbiology:

Microbial Growth and Morphology: Examining bacterial and fungal cultures in liquid media.  

Microbial Interactions: Studying interactions between microorganisms, such as predator-prey relationships and biofilm formation.

Materials Science:

Surface Analysis: Examining surface features of materials, such as crystal structures and defects.

Particle Analysis: Observing and characterizing microscopic particles.  

Biomedical Research:

Drug Discovery: Screening for drug efficacy and toxicity on living cells.  

Immunology: Studying immune cell responses and interactions.  

Developmental Biology: Observing embryonic development and tissue differentiation.
